Nice hotel next to the marina on Hayling Island. Check in was quick and efficient for our three night stay. The hotel is quite spread out and our room was a bit of a walk down the corridor. Bar was well stocked with over 100 guns and whiskeys. Bar staff were very knowledgeable and helpful. Dining room has excellent views across the bay if you are lucky enough to get a wind table. Breakfast is buffet style and all the morning foods you would expect. My only negative comment is that they had a function on the Saturday night in the room next to us which was loud. They could have thought a big about it and assigned us a room further away. All in all an enjoyable stay.

The Brasserie at The Langstone Hotel in Hayling Island does not currently hold any awards from any leading restaurant guide. It may or may not be closed.
The Brasserie at The Langstone Hotel is not currently listed in the Michelin Guide.
The Brasserie at The Langstone Hotel does not currently hold any AA Rosettes, however the restaurant previously held 2 AA Rosettes until August 2018.
